Propane Water Heater Service in Denver, CO
Propane water heater services include installation, routine maintenance, and repairs for homes that rely on propane to heat their water. These services ensure that propane water heaters operate efficiently and safely, providing reliable hot water for daily needs. Projects typically involve replacing an aging unit, upgrading to a more energy-efficient model, or addressing issues such as leaks, inconsistent heating, or pilot light problems. Property owners often want to understand the different types of propane water heaters available, the signs indicating a need for service, and the importance of regular inspections to prevent potential safety concerns.
Before requesting propane water heater services, homeowners should consider the age and condition of their current unit, as well as any recent performance issues like fluctuating water temperature or unusual noises. It’s also helpful to know the specific model and capacity of the existing heater to ensure compatibility with new installations or repairs. Understanding the scope of work involved, including whether system upgrades or code compliance updates are necessary, can assist property owners in making informed decisions about their hot water systems.

Propane Water Heater Service Questions
How do I know if my propane water heater needs service? Signs include inconsistent hot water, strange noises, or increased energy use. Regular inspections can help identify issues early.
What types of repairs are common for propane water heaters? Common repairs involve thermocouple replacement, sediment removal, and fixing thermostat or valve problems.
Can a propane water heater be safely upgraded or replaced? Yes, upgrading or replacing with a new unit can improve efficiency and reliability for household hot water needs.
What maintenance tasks can help extend the life of a propane water heater? Flushing the tank annually and checking for leaks or corrosion can help maintain optimal operation.
